I have an Icecap set and Id have to say it is a huge improvement over ABS SA. In overall sound and the texture of the caps themselves. They arent shiny like ABS-SA and they have a micro texture, which is a good thing. Old SA caps are (IMO) beyond terrible to type on i have a full Carbon SA set and I cant even use it to type really.
I like the new PBT SA caps for sure

Really? Then Ice Cap is very different from the Industrial SA set that came after it. Industrial keycaps look and feel identical to the semigloss ABS keycaps we are all used to. In fact, if you didn't turn one over and look at it from the bottom, you'd probably never know it was a dyesub PBT keycap.
